Curate
How do i see myself in ubiquitous ICT learning environment?
- Pinterest
Curation is a response to abundance of information is still an emerging practice but the
essential features appear to be that it:
1. Presents high quality content selected for its relevance to a specific topic (seek)
2. Includes description and comment that adds value to the content (sense), amd
3. Is published so that it is available to, and engages, interested colleagues (share).
